Description
- What is Tap Wine? Served directly from the barrel, tap wine maintains the freshness and vibrancy of the wine, offering a taste that is as close as possible to a cellar-door experience.
- Origin: Harvested from the prestigious Mukuzani appellation within the Kakheti region of Georgia, renowned for producing top-quality wines. Made by the Karalashvili Wine Cellar.
- Grape Variety: Crafted exclusively from Saperavi grapes, celebrated for their robustness and depth.
- Taste Profile: This wine displays a deep, dark red color with sophisticated aromas of black cherry, blackberry, and subtle hints of vanilla and spice. On the palate, it offers well-integrated tannins and a smooth, velvety finish.
- Wine Character: Mukuzani is often referred to as the 'Bordeaux of Georgia,' known for its aging potential and elegance. The tap serving method captures and delivers its refined character with every glass.
Details
- Craftsmanship: The Saperavi grapes are meticulously aged in oak barrels for 6 months, which imparts additional complexity and smoothness to the wine, enhancing its natural flavors and aromatic profile.
- Serving Suggestions: A perfect match for red meats, game, hearty pastas, and aged cheeses. Its robust profile can also beautifully complement rich, spicy dishes.
- Enjoy Fresh: Serve this wine slightly below room temperature to best appreciate its intricate flavors and aromatic nuances.
